Mills CNC to showcase multi-tasking mill-turn machineLeamington Spa-based Mills CNC, the exclusive distributor of DN Solutions’ and Zayer machine tools in the UK and Ireland, is showcasing a high-performance, multi-tasking mill-turn machine at the Southern Manufacturing & Electronics 2025 (Stand C160), which takes place at the Farnborough International Exhibition Centre, 4-6 February.

The machine, a DN Solutions’ SMX 2100SB, is a popular and proven machine that delivers high accuracies, fast processing speeds and unrivalled machining flexibility; with its five-axis simultaneous machining capabilities it is ideal for component manufacturers looking to process complex, high-precision parts in one hit.

The SMX 2100SB is equipped with the latest, advanced Fanuc 31i-Plus control and features two, left and right, opposing 8in and 10in chuck (4,000 and 5,000rev/min) spindles, a 12,000rev/min B-axis milling head, a 40-tool position, servo-driven ATC with its own touchscreen operating panel, and a 12/24-position lower turret with 5,000rev/min driven tooling capabilities.

In addition to its rigid design and build, the SMX 2100SB comes supplied with high-precision roller-type LM guideways that minimise non-cutting time, and integrated thermal compensation that ensures high accuracies over long machining runs and lengthy periods of operation.
